diff options
author | estade@chromium.org <estade@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2009-10-05 17:28:04 +0000 |
---|---|---|
committer | estade@chromium.org <estade@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2009-10-05 17:28:04 +0000 |
commit | bc77765e44ca594f4b2501db7a7c7411220552a9 (patch) | |
tree | 3e9791b792567622227245d41200a80d46e46cfc /chrome | |
parent | e0cd12237c3ce5edf64b66d1d3692255364a5bf1 (diff) | |
download | chromium_src-bc77765e44ca594f4b2501db7a7c7411220552a9.zip chromium_src-bc77765e44ca594f4b2501db7a7c7411220552a9.tar.gz chromium_src-bc77765e44ca594f4b2501db7a7c7411220552a9.tar.bz2 |
Task Manager: show right click context menu no matter where you click on the task manager window.
discoverability++
Review URL: http://codereview.chromium.org/203047
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@28005 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'chrome')
-rw-r--r-- | chrome/browser/gtk/task_manager_gtk.cc | 4 | ||||
-rw-r--r-- | chrome/browser/views/task_manager_view.cc | 1 |
2 files changed, 1 insertions, 4 deletions
diff --git a/chrome/browser/gtk/task_manager_gtk.cc b/chrome/browser/gtk/task_manager_gtk.cc index daa1b0b..f9095d0 100644 --- a/chrome/browser/gtk/task_manager_gtk.cc +++ b/chrome/browser/gtk/task_manager_gtk.cc @@ -802,10 +802,6 @@ gboolean TaskManagerGtk::OnButtonPressEvent(GtkWidget* widget, gboolean TaskManagerGtk::OnButtonReleaseEvent(GtkWidget* widget, GdkEventButton* event, TaskManagerGtk* task_manager) { - // We don't want to open the context menu in the treeview. - if (gtk_util::WidgetContainsCursor(task_manager->treeview_)) - return FALSE; - if (event->button == 3) task_manager->ShowContextMenu(); diff --git a/chrome/browser/views/task_manager_view.cc b/chrome/browser/views/task_manager_view.cc index d605b77..2572cd0 100644 --- a/chrome/browser/views/task_manager_view.cc +++ b/chrome/browser/views/task_manager_view.cc @@ -343,6 +343,7 @@ void TaskManagerView::Init() { UpdateStatsCounters(); tab_table_->SetObserver(this); + tab_table_->SetContextMenuController(this); SetContextMenuController(this); // If we're running with --purge-memory-button, add a "Purge memory" button. if (CommandLine::ForCurrentProcess()->HasSwitch( |